Originally released in 2000. Flowers for Algernon is a drama film. directed by Jeff Bleckner.

Starring Matthew Modine, Kelli Williams, and Ron Rifkin

Synopsis

Charlie Gordon is mentally handicapped and all he wants in life is to be a genius. When he gets picked for experimental surgery it looks like his dream may finally come true. But the surgery has side effects that could could kill Charlie. Can Charlie survive being just plain old "Charlie Gordon" and will his newfound romance survive this test of character?
